Reviewed 28 week(s) ago

Expedia Group verified review

From arrival & pulling up in front of the beautiful grand house, full of old world charm, to checking in to our well appointed junior suite, the staff were attentive & polite, the food was delicious, locally sourced & served with attention to detail. The bar provided a fantastic selection of food & drinks & Champagne seemed to be the order of the day, we even tried a pint of Clarkson's local brew. Set in its own well kept grounds over looking Cheltenham racecourse, which was only a short walk though beautiful countryside, we felt a sense of tranquility & relaxation. With a lovely heated outdoor pool & entertainment areas, our stay never felt over crowded. After our 2 night stay we felt refreshed, having been well attended to by the staff. Check out came all too soon from this 5 Star luxury hotel & we left following an amazing breakfast. If you want to enjoy a quiet & unassuming luxury hotel, oozing with history & class, Ellenborough Park certainly ticks all the right boxes.

Reviewed 33 week(s) ago

Expedia Group verified review

The 'Spa' was fairly limited with just a hot tub, sauna, steam room and 6 beds. Based on this, i wouldn't say it's a spa hotel, just a hotel with a small spa add-on. Its was great weather which meant there weren't enough beds by the outdoor heated pool so there wasnt really anywhere for us to go. The treatments were good, but I think overpriced. The restaurant was not good at catering to my food intollerances, even serving me food which contained my intollerances by mistake. They didn't have much they could adapt on the menu which was disappointing. I think the staff could have been more attentive, and they didn't seem that knowledgable about what was available (except the spa staff who were great).
